Battery Charger IC market is segmented by Type, and by Application. Players, stakeholders, and other participants in the global Battery Charger IC market will be able to gain the upper hand as they use the report as a powerful resource. The segmental analysis focuses on production capacity, revenue and forecast by Type and by Application for the period 2015-2026.

Segment by Type, the Battery Charger IC market is segmented into
Li-ion Charger Ics
Super Capacitor Charger Ics
Lead Acid Charger Ics
Others

Segment by Application, the Battery Charger IC market is segmented into
Consumer Electronics
Automotive
Power Industry
Other
